一、项目背景与目标:
随着智慧城市概念的不断深入和普及,如何利用先进的技术手段来提升城市管理效率和服务水平成为了当前的重要课题。为了响应这一需求,本方案旨在开发一套物联网系统解决方案,通过集成多种传感器设备和技术框架,实现对城市环境数据的有效采集、传输与分析。
二、功能模块介绍:
1. 数据采集: 该模块负责从各种类型的智能硬件(如温度湿度计、烟雾探测器等)收集原始信息。我们将使用MQTT协议进行数据传输,以确保通信的低延迟和高效率。
2. 实时监控与报警:
- 此功能模块用于对采集到的数据实时展示,并设置阈值触发警报机制。采用D3.js库进行数据可视化,帮助用户直观地理解环境状态。
- 通过搭建基于Hadoop的分布式文件系统来实现海量历史记录的安全保存与快速检索。同时利用Spark流处理技术进行实时数据分析,为决策提供依据。
- 为了保障系统的安全性和稳定性,在此模块中实现多级用户角色定义以及细粒度操作权限分配功能。使用Spring Security框架进行认证授权处理。
- 开发一款移动应用程序,使得管理者可以随时随地通过智能手机或平板电脑查看系统的各项运行状态并执行相关操作命令。采用React Native技术栈构建跨平台的原生体验。
- MQTT协议在物联网领域中广泛使用,它具有轻量级且支持多种网络环境的特点,在保证数据传输速率的同时也能有效减少能耗消耗。适合用于传感器设备间的数据交互。
- 预计整个项目的研发时间约为12个月,其中包括需求调研(30天)、设计规划阶段(60天)、编码实现期(8个月)以及测试上线准备和维护工作等。
- - 前端开发工程师:4人;
- - 后台架构师及程序员:6人;
- - 数据库管理员与安全专家各1名。
- 本项目方案旨在通过先进的物联网技术,为智慧城市建设提供全面的数据支持和管理工具。我们相信,在团队的共同努力下定能打造出高效可靠的解决方案。
欢迎咨询:18969108718(陈经理) 微信同号。
3. 数据存储和分析:
4. 用户管理及权限控制:
5. 移动应用端:
三、关键技术选型及考量:
四、开发周期预估与技术难点分析:
五、人员配置建议:
六、结语:
